Abstract

The invention provides a gear compensation and correction method of a straight gear injection mould. Each single tooth on the injection mould is numbered, injection process parameters of the injection mould are set, and a gear sample is produced; an upper cross section and a lower cross section of the gear sample produced in the last step are selected, all-geared continuous scanning is conducted by utilization of a coordinate measuring machine, and scanning data are input into an excel form; actual distribution of the single teeth is compared with theoretical data, and the tooth form, the tooth crest radius position and the involute line shape of each single tooth are analyzed; the position and the involute shape of each single tooth are recalculated based on an analytical result in the sixth step, and tooth shape compensation and correction of the injection mould are conducted; and a new gear injection mould is machined for producing gears according to data after compensation and correction are conducted. The gear precision level is improved by utilization of current three schemes for glue feeding, precision requirements of the injection mould are improved on the premise that the injection cost is not increased, and the consistent mode dimensional precision of machining through the same machine is guaranteed.

Description

technical field [0001] The invention relates to a method for compensating and correcting plastic gears. Background technique [0002] Due to the advancement of science and technology, products are becoming more and more complex, especially in order to reduce the space weight of automotive plastic parts, meet the requirements of energy saving, environmental protection, and cost reduction, more parts are replaced by plastics. And cost control is also more stringent. Therefore, optimizing the production process of plastic parts, ensuring quality requirements and reducing costs have become urgent problems to be solved. Existing spur gear injection molds usually adopt a relatively balanced glue feeding method with 3 or more points of glue feeding, which can ensure gear parts with a certain meshing accuracy.
